Bunk beds can be found in several designs to fit varied choices and requirements. Here are some popular choices:
Standard Bunk Bed: This traditional design features 2 beds stacked vertically, usually with a ladder entrance.
Loft Bed: This design has only the top bunk, permitting open space below, which can be utilized for a desk, seating, or storage.
L-Shaped Bunk bed Bunk For sale: Arranged at right angles, this design uses a distinct style and provides extra space for additional furniture.
Twin Over Full: This style features a twin mattress on leading and a full-sized bed mattress on the bottom, accommodating more sleeping space.
Triple Bunk Bed: Great for bigger families, this design features three stacked beds but might require higher ceilings.

The choice between wood and metal mainly depends upon personal preference and designated usage. Solid wood is long lasting and attractive, while metal is generally more affordable and lighter.
How high should the ceiling be for a bunk bed?
A ceiling height of at least 8 feet is typically advised for a basic bunk bed. It enables adequate space between the leading bunk and the ceiling for safety and comfort.
Can adults sleep on bunk beds?
Yes, lots of bunk beds are developed to accommodate adults, but it is vital to examine the weight capability and stability of the bed.
Exist any special bed mattress requirements for bunk beds?
Numerous bunk beds support standard mattress sizes, however it's vital to verify the thickness and dimensions for the best fit and safety.
How can I guarantee the longevity of a bunk bed?
Routine maintenance, such as looking for loose screws, guaranteeing mattress supports remain in place, and keeping the bunk bed clean, will help prolong its life expectancy.
